Mental illness focus group forming

The Snoqualmie Valley Community Network is partnering with King County to form a focus group that will help inform the county’s decisions around its investments related to mental illness and drug dependency renewal.

Interested participants are invited to a facilitated group discussion, 11 a.m. to 1 p.m. Friday, Jan. 22 at the Preston Community Center. The discussion is designed to gather perspectives of Snoqualmie Valley service providers and residents. People from all walks of life are welcome, including those who have experience with mental health or substance abuse treatment, those who may want services but can’t access them, family members, providers,  volunteers and community leaders. People in recovery are especially encouraged to participate.
